1936 Wauwatosa Colonial Kitchen Remodeling

The homeowners loved the look of granite, but did not want the maintenance of this type of product. Therefore, Zodiac countertops were installed, a quartz-based product that looks very similar to granite, but does not have the same maintenance issues. Mystic Black was chosen for the main body of the kitchen to provide for a contrasting look to the cabinets and Indus Red was chosen as an accent piece for the island to coordinate with the red knobs of the Viking range top. An Elkay stainless steel sink and Moen stainless steel faucet tie in nicely with the stainless steel appliances. To improve lighting, six recessed lights on a dimmer switch were installed in the ceiling along with two areas for drop pendant lights – over the sink and over the island. Traditional time period light fixtures were used with white alabaster shades. Under cabinet task lighting was also used, along with the accent lighting at the top of the upper cabinets that were dropped down from the ceiling.
